There are reports several WWE staff members have been having frequent meetings. In these meetings they have discussed promotion related topics. What the World Wrestling Entertainment wants to accomplish is to find younger talent to deal with day to day operations for arranging bouts in all title divisions. Their goals are to have talent of youth to incorporate their ideas into the WWE storyline in hope of fresh ideas that may be appealing to the fans.

Dave Meltzer of the Wrestling Observer has reported that WWE has promoted cruiserweight Jamie Noble. He will not only wrestle but have the job description of a producer and agent and will be in charge of match making.
